Lexmark x1270 drivers on F12

Hey folks,

I tried Googling the forums for info on this printer but came up with a non-answer. The only thing I could find related to network printing.
The machine I am setting up is stand alone, and I don't think they want another computer just to control their printer.

Does anyone know where I might find a Lexmark x1270 driver for Fedora 12?

If not the exact model even a driver for similar model will do. Preferably one that has colour support.

Re: Lexmark x1270 drivers on F12

Lexmark has been notorious for not providing Linux printer drivers, but, I've heard some are being released. The first link, when looking at some printer models, has rpm's for drivers. Some, like the x1270 don't, but maybe you can get lucky with a model that is similar. The second link has user made drivers from Linux.com (OpenPrinting). Good Luck, and please come back and tell us if you have any luck.

Re: Lexmark x1270 drivers on F12

Hi GoinEasy9,

Thanks for those links,

I've already checked out the first one.
No Linux support for the x1270.
Support for different versions of Windows on some of their models is patchy!

The second URl was alot more helpful. The X series is not well supported, but apparently an x600 driver should handle the printing duties at a lower resolution, and SANE should take care of the scanner.
